This announcement is a Sources Sought (market research) Notice. This is not a Request for Quote (RFQ) or Request for Proposal (RFP). This announcement is for information and planning purposes only and is not to be taken as a commitment by the Government, implied or otherwise, to issue a solicitation or award a contract. The following draft performance work statement is for Base Operations Preventive Maintenance and Repair (PMR) services (including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ning [HVAC], Fire Alarm & Mass Notification Systems, Emergency Lighting & Exit Signs, and Lightning Protection Systems) at Kahuku Training Area (KTA), Island of Oahu, State of Hawaii. The purpose of this sources sought notice is to determine the interest and capability of potential qualified small business firms relative to North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) code 561210 (Facilities Support Services). Please provide the following information on your capability statement: 1) Your intent to submit a quote for this requirement when it is formally advertised. 2) Name of firm with address, phone number, e-mail address, and point of contact. 3) CAGE Code and Unique Entity Identifier (UEI) 4) Size of firm including category of small business, such as 8(a), Women-Owned Small Business (WOSB), HUBZone, Small Disadvantaged Veteran Owned Small Business (SDVOSB); and 5) Statement of Capability stating your skills, experience, and knowledge required to perform the specific type of work. Firms responding to this sources sought notice who fail to provide all the required information requested will not be used to assist the Government in the acquisition strategy decision, which is the intent of this sources sought notice. Email your capability response to Travis Tonini at travis.c.tonini.civ@army.mil by September 03, 2026, at 10:00 AM Hawaii Standard Time (HST). NOTE: IF YOU DO NOT INTEND TO SUBMIT A QUOTE FOR THIS REQUIREMENT WHEN IT IS FORMALLY ADVERTISED, PLEASE DO NOT SUBMIT A RESPONSE TO THIS SOURCES SOUGHT NOTICE.
